Budget

Basic rotary or slide dimmer replacing an existing single-pole switch, per switch

Mid-Range

LED-compatible decora dimmer with preset levels, per switch, including testing with existing fixtures

Premium

Smart dimmer with Wi-Fi, app control, and voice assistant integration, per switch, including setup and configuration

Material Options

Material prices below are national averages; availability in Detroit may shift costs slightly.

MaterialCost/UnitBest For
Basic Rotary/Slide Dimmer$8-$15 eachClosets, garages, and areas with incandescent or halogen lightingCheapest option, simple operation, works with incandescent and some LED
LED-Compatible (CL) Dimmer$15-$40 eachMost rooms in the home - the best general-purpose optionSmooth LED dimming, multiple preset levels, modern decora style, reliable
Smart Dimmer (Wi-Fi)$40-$80 eachLiving rooms, bedrooms, and frequently used spaces in smart homesVoice and app control, scheduling, scene setting, energy monitoring on some models
Smart Dimmer System (Lutron Caseta, etc.)$60-$120 each (including hub cost)Whole-home smart lighting with the best reliability and compatibilityMost reliable smart dimming, no neutral wire needed, Pico remotes, geofencing
